PowerPoint includes proofing tools (spelling dictionaries, thesauri, and grammar rules) for more than one language. If you use English as your main language, then Spanish and French dictionaries may be already installed — this enables you to spell check Spanish and French words. The chart templates you save within PowerPoint 2013 are saved into a default folder location which you do not have to worry about, as far as you are using those templates on same computer where they are saved. However, if you need to share these CRTX chart templates with other users, or if you received a CRTX chart template from someone else, then you need to make sure that these CRTX files are placed in the default location where PowerPoint 2013 looks for them.
